This AI-generated tattoo project presents a high-contrast black and grey portrait of a horned Viking crown, rendered in a bold yet refined fine-line style. The design relies on dense linework, crisp cross-hatching, and deliberate negative space to carve the helmet’s curvature, the menacing horns, and the crested brow, while the beard unfolds in sweeping ribbons that braid into a decorative heart-shaped motif at the chest. Textural variation is achieved through parallel strokes, stippling, and strategic ink density, giving the piece a dynamic sense of depth that remains legible from a distance and richly detailed up close. The crown is treated as a metallic construct, with studs and rivets suggested by small white highlights and careful shading, pairing with the textured plates to create a stoic, timeless silhouette. The beard acts as both a visual anchor and an ornamental element, its fronds tumbling downward in a cascade of curves that echo the surrounding pattern work, which adds graphic density without overwhelming the central portrait. The overall composition prioritizes verticality, making it well-suited for placement on the upper arm, back, or calf as a bold, enduring tattoo design.
